5. Eto
Follow these steps to set up your power supply:
- Ṣayẹwo Input Voltage Yipada: Before connecting any power, locate the input voltage selector switch on the unit. Ensure it is set to either 110V or 220V, matching your local mains power supply.
Ikilọ: Setting the switch incorrectly can cause severe damage to the power supply and connected devices.
- Awọn isopọ Waya: Connect your AC input wires and DC output wires to the appropriate terminals. Refer to Figure 4 for terminal identification.

Nọmba 4: Alaye view of the terminal connections. Ensure correct wiring for Live (L), Neutral (N), Earth (GND), Negative (-), Positive (+), and ADJ for voltage tolesese. - Iṣawọle AC: Connect the Live wire to 'L' and the Neutral wire to 'N'. Connect the Earth wire to the 'GND' terminal.
- DC Iṣelọpọ: Connect the positive lead of your device to '+' and the negative lead to '-'.
- ADJ Potentiometer: If using the external potentiometer for voltage adjustment, connect it to the 'ADJ' terminals as shown.
- Awọn isopọ to ni aabo: Ensure all wire connections are tight and secure to prevent loose contacts and potential hazards.
6. Awọn ilana Iṣiṣẹ
Once the power supply is correctly wired and the input voltage switch is set:
- Agbara Tan: Connect the AC input to your mains power supply. The LED display on the unit should illuminate, showing the current output voltage.
- Ṣatunṣe Ijade Voltage: Use the built-in or external ADJ potentiometer to adjust the DC output voltage to your desired level (0-12V). Turn clockwise to increase voltage, counter-clockwise to decrease.
- Atẹle Ijade: Observe the LED display to confirm the output voltage. If connecting sensitive equipment, it is recommended to verify the voltage with a multimeter before connecting the load.
- Ẹrù Sopọ̀: Lọgan ti o fẹ voltage is set, connect your DC-powered device to the output terminals. Ensure the device's current and power requirements do not exceed 2A and 25W, respectively.
- Agbara Pa: To turn off the power supply, disconnect it from the AC mains.

8. Laasigbotitusita
Ti o ba pade awọn ọran pẹlu ipese agbara rẹ, tọka si awọn iṣoro ti o wọpọ ati awọn ojutu wọnyi:
| Isoro | Owun to le Fa | Ojutu |
|---|---|---|
| Ko si voltage / LED display off | No AC input power, incorrect input voltage switch setting, loose connections, internal fault. | Check AC power source. Verify input voltage switch (110V/220V) is correct. Inspect all wiring for secure connections. If problem persists, contact support. |
| O wu voltage unstable or fluctuating | Overload, faulty load, loose ADJ potentiometer connection, internal fault. | Reduce load to below 2A/25W. Disconnect load and test power supply independently. Check ADJ potentiometer wiring. |
| Power supply gets excessively hot | Insufficient ventilation, continuous overload, high ambient temperature. | Ensure clear airflow around the unit. Reduce load. Operate within specified temperature range. |
| Protection features (overload, short circuit) frequently activate | Load exceeding specifications, short circuit in connected device, incorrect wiring. | Verify load requirements are within 2A/25W. Check connected device for short circuits. Re-examine all wiring. |
